函式名:OAuth::disableDebug()
函式說明:該函式用於禁用 OAuth 擴充套件的除錯模式。
適用版本:該函式適用於 PHP 5 >= 5.3.0, PECL oauth >= 0.99.0.
語法:bool OAuth::disableDebug()
引數:該函式沒有引數。
返回值:如果成功禁用除錯模式,則返回 true。如果在呼叫此函式時出現錯誤,則返回 false。
示例:
// 建立 OAuth 物件
$oauth = new OAuth('consumer_key', 'consumer_secret');
// 啟用除錯模式(預設為啟用)
$oauth->enableDebug();
// 執行一些 OAuth 操作,進行除錯
// 禁用除錯模式
$oauth->disableDebug();
// 繼續其他 OAuth 操作,此時不會輸出除錯資訊
注意事項:
- 除錯模式預設是啟用的,可以使用 enableDebug() 函式啟用。
- 除錯模式啟用後,OAuth 擴充套件會輸出詳細的除錯資訊,包括 HTTP 請求和響應的頭部資訊。
- 禁用除錯模式後,OAuth 擴充套件不會輸出除錯資訊,有利於生產環境的安全和效能。
- 在除錯模式下,可能會洩漏敏感資訊,因此在生產環境中應禁用除錯模式。
- 如果禁用除錯模式時出現錯誤,可以透過檢查返回值來確定是否成功禁用。